Key Characteristics of Effective Solar Logos
Symbolism and Imagery
When thinking about solar logos, imagery is your best friend. Utilizing symbols like suns, solar panels, and nature elements can evoke a sense of eco-friendliness and innovation. For instance, a rising sun can symbolize new beginnings and sustainability, while a solar panel can directly relate to the service you provide. Combining these elements into your design will help potential customers understand your business's purpose immediately.
Photo by Kindel Media
Color Psychology
Colors are not just decorative; they carry emotional weight. In the solar industry, colors like yellow, green, and blue are particularly significant. Yellow reflects energy and optimism, much like the sun itself. Green symbolizes sustainability and nature, aligning perfectly with eco-conscious consumers. Blue represents trust and reliability, crucial traits for any service provider. By strategically choosing your color palette, you can evoke the right feelings associated with solar energy.
Typography Choices
Your font selection is vital in conveying the personality of your brand. Bold, sans-serif fonts can give a modern and clean look, while softer serif fonts may evoke warmth and approachability. Be mindful of how your typography aligns with your brand’s message. Would you prefer a techy feel or one that’s more homey? Choose fonts that reflect your vision and resonate with your target audience.
Simplicity and Versatility
A successful logo is often simple yet memorable. Think about it: you want potential customers to recognize your logo in an instant. Complex designs may lose clarity, especially when scaled down. Aim for a design that’s versatile enough to work across various platforms, from business cards to large banners. A clean, simple logo can make a significant impact.
Design Principles for Residential Solar Logos
Brainstorming Techniques
When it comes to ideation, don't hesitate to think outside the box. Start by jotting down keywords related to your business—words like sustainable, energy, and homeownership. Use these words as a springboard for symbols, colors, and layouts. Consider visual associations: for instance, if you think of "light", you might envision a bright sun or rays shining down.
Mockups and Prototyping
Creating mockups is essential to visualize your logo in real-world applications. Whether you use digital tools or sketches, seeing your logo on various items, such as a truck, business card, or website, can reveal how it performs in different contexts. Look for the strengths and weaknesses in your designs. Adjust accordingly to ensure it meets your expectations.
Feedback and Revisions
Gathering feedback is one of the most valuable steps in the design process. Share your logos with potential customers, friends, or fellow businesses in the solar industry. Ask for their impressions—what stands out, and what might be confusing? Use this constructive criticism to refine your design further.
Trends in Solar Industry Logo Design
Minimalist Designs
Today's design trends favor minimalism. This approach not only enhances clarity but also projects confidence in your brand. Consider clean lines and limited color palettes. A minimalist logo can effectively communicate your brand message without overwhelming the viewer.
Eco-Friendly Themes
As sustainability is at the heart of the solar industry, eco-friendly themes in logo designs are becoming prevalent. Incorporating elements like leaves, earth tones, or recycling symbols can enhance your message. This alignment not only appeals to environmentally conscious customers but reinforces your commitment to sustainable practices.
Dynamic Elements
Incorporating dynamic elements or movement can convey the energy and vibrancy of solar power. This can be achieved through the use of gradients or abstract shapes that mimic solar rays. Such designs can resonate well in an industry devoted to progress and innovation.
